    TLS is not async-signal-safe, making its use in the signal handler used to detect stack overflows unsound (c.f. rust-lang#133698). POSIX however lists two thread-specific identifiers that can be obtained in a signal handler: the current `pthread_t` and the address of `errno`. Since `pthread_equal` is not AS-safe, `pthread_t` should be considered opaque, so for our purposes, `&errno` is the only option. This however works nicely: we can use the address as a key into a map that stores information for each thread. This PR uses a `BTreeMap` protected by a spin lock to hold the guard page address and thread name and thus fixes rust-lang#133698.

Use the existing Lemire (decimal -> float) and Dragon / Grisu algorithms (float -> decimal) to add support for `f16`. This allows updating the implementation for `Display` to the expected behavior for `Display` (currently it prints the a hex bitwise representation), matching other floats, and adds a `FromStr` implementation. In order to avoid crashes when compiling with Cranelift or on targets where f16 is not well supported, a fallback is used if `cfg(target_has_reliable_f16)` is not true.
Extend the existing tests for `f32` and `f64` with versions that include `f16`'s new printing and parsing implementations. Co-authored-by: Speedy_Lex <[email protected]>
This requires a fix to the subnormal test to cap the maximum allowed value within the maximum mantissa.

Remove #![feature(let_chains)] from library and src/librustdoc PR rust-lang#132833 has stabilized the `let_chains` feature. This PR removes the last occurences from the library, the compiler, and librustdoc (also because rust-lang#140887 missed the conditional in one of the crates as it was behind the "rustc" feature). We keep `core` as exercise for the future as updating it is non-trivial (see PR thread).
